A quick glance at the appointments:

  1. St Helens vs Leigh Leopards: Referee - Aaron Moore, Video Referee - Chris Kendall
  2. Bradford Bulls vs Catalans Dragons: Referee - Liam Rush, Video Referee - Tom Grant
  3. Leeds Rhinos vs York Knights: Referee - James Vella, Video Referee - Jack Smith
  4. Toulouse Olympique vs Castleford Tigers: Referee - Marcus Griffiths, Video Referee - Liam Moore
  5. Wigan Warriors vs Hull FC: Referee - Tom Grant, Video Referee - Aaron Moore
  6. Huddersfield Giants vs Wakefield Trinity: Referee - Jack Smith, Video Referee - James Vella
